Why Choose B.SC in Physical Education at Seoul National University, South Korea

Choosing a B.Sc. in Physical Education at Seoul National University (SNU) offers a prestigious opportunity to study at South Korea's leading institution. SNU provides world-class facilities, expert faculty, and a rigorous curriculum, ensuring a solid foundation in both theoretical and practical aspects of physical education. The program emphasizes research, sports science, and holistic physical well-being. With SNU's strong global reputation, students gain exposure to diverse cultures and a competitive edge in the global job market. Additionally, the vibrant campus life and proximity to South Korea's dynamic sports scene provide ample opportunities for personal and professional growth.


B.SC in Physical Education at Seoul National University, South Korea, Program Details
 

Aspect

Details

Program Name

Bachelor of Science in Physical Education

Degree Awarded

B.Sc. in Physical Education

Course Duration

4 years

Language of Instruction

Korean (Some courses may be offered in English)

Yearly Tuition Fees

Approximately 6,000,000 to 7,000,000 (varies based on program)

Total Tuition Fees

24,000,000 to 28,000,000 (over 4 years)

Total Program Cost

Varies; includes tuition, accommodation, and living expenses

Eligibility

High school diploma or equivalent; proficiency in Korean or English (if applicable)

Admission Requirements

High school transcripts, proof of language proficiency (Korean or English), entrance exam (if applicable)

Application Intake

Typically in spring (March) and fall (September)

Scholarship

Scholarships may be available based on merit and financial need

Career Prospects

Sports coaching, fitness training, physical education teaching, sports management, rehabilitation, sports research

Curriculum Structure

 Core subjects in physical education, sports science, and anatomy
 Practical training in sports management and coaching
 Electives in specialized areas like sports psychology or kinesiology
 Internship opportunities in the sports field
